Oil Plam Fruit Classification Using Spectrometer.
Artificial neural network and linear discriminant analysis were used to detect the ripeness of oil palm fruit bunches. The proposed classification scheme categorized the oil palm fruits into three classes, namely, overripe, ripe, and under-ripe. Fruit color, presumed to be an important indicator of...
